Abstract

Adaptive systems are a promising approach to reduce driver distraction caused by using functions of the infotainment system while driving. The number of operation steps can be reduced through proactive recommendations based on the user behavior in the past. We describe the methods and results conducted in the first two iterations of an user-centered design process to develop an interaction concept for an adaptive recommendation service. The result of an extensive requirements analysis is described and how different concepts perform in comparison with each other.
